hey keith i got a tablet for Christmas, and i cannot draw real good at all, think you could help me? (ps: it came with corel painter essentials 4)
Hmmmm, my advice to you will be the same that I give to everyone. If you can't draw good with pencil and paper, no digital medium will help you. The key to drawing what's in your head without frustration is understanding form and shape, and using a pencil is the easiest way to practice that.
But tablets can be great fun to play around with. If you want to just dive in and get crazy, take a look at "mood paintings". They tend to be very rough with form and shape, but instead focus on portraying powerful images through light and color. You may find that mood paintings are fun and not too tough to do. They lend themselves to a bit more creativity than realistic imagery.
